LBJ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review

5 of the 3,481 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Direxion Daily Latin America Bull 2X Shares (LBJ)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$928K — down 19% from $1.15M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 4 funds opened new LBJ posit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 0 added to existing stakes and 1 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, opening a new position worth an estimated $553K. The largest seller was Jane Street, cutting an estimated $716K.
